President

In March 2004, Jean-Jack Queyranne was elected to the post of President of the Rhône-Alpes Regional Council by the regional councillors.

In his capacity as President, he has a variety of duties:
he draws up and implements the Regional Council's decisions and rulings
he monitors regional income and expenditure
he signs orders and decrees, agreements and contracts, and is empowered to file lawsuits on behalf of the Regional Council
he leads the Regional Council's departments and appoints its officers - he manages the Region's assets.

Short biography
President of the Rhône-Alpes Regional Council since 2004, MP for the Rhône since 1981 (re-elected in 1986, 1988, 1997, 2002 and 2007) Jean-Jack QUEYRANNE is also a member of the Constitutional Acts, Legislation and General Administration Committee and of the National Assembly study group on Towns and Suburbs. He was Secretary of State for Overseas Territories from 1997 to 1998, acting Interior Minister in 1998, and then Minister of Parliamentary Relations from 2000 to 2002. Jean-Jack QUEYRANNE was Deputy Mayor of Villeurbanne from 1983 to 1988, Mayor of Bron from 1989 to 1997, and then Deputy Mayor from 1997 to 2004. He holds a PhD in Political Sciences and is a senior lecturer at Lumière-Lyon II University.
